Excerpt from The Passing of Thomas: And Other Stories

In an agony Of tears. From the days Of his very earliest kittenhood she had loved Thomas tenderly, and through all the fifteen years of their affection ate companionship her love for him steadily had increased. It was a most bitter blow that their parting had come at last, and in what seemed to be so cruel a way.
